                Explore Aircraft Mechanic Jobs in the US

                Airplane mechanics support all flight operations by making sure planes stay secure and work properly. They do system assessments and repair work to maintain planes in their highest-performing condition. For those beginning their careers, aircraft mechanic hiring offers entry-level positions that provide hands-on training and the chance to work on a variety of aircraft. These roles help new mechanics build technical skills and gain certifications, such as the FAA Airframe and Powerplant (A&P) license. Professional aircraft mechanics can find job opportunities to work with avionic systems, turbine engines, and repair structures.

                Responsibilities of an Aircraft Mechanic

                Aircraft mechanics ensure planes remain in top condition. They check airplanes often to find any problems. Finding and fixing mechanical issues is an important part of their job. They repair or replace broken parts to keep planes working. They work on engines, hydraulic systems, and airplane structures. They also keep careful records to follow FAA safety rules. Their job helps keep passengers and crew safe.

                Frequently asked questions

                To qualify for aircraft mechanic jobs in the United States, individuals can complete an FAA-approved maintenance technician program or gain equivalent experience through on-the-job training. Afterward, passing the FAA's written and practical exams is necessary to obtain an Airframe and/or Powerplant (A&P) certificate, enabling them to pursue aircraft mechanic roles.

                Aircraft mechanic recruitment typically requires around 18 months to 2 years for individuals to complete training and obtain the necessary certifications to become an aircraft mechanic.

                In aviation mechanic jobs, different levels of aircraft mechanics include entry-level, intermediate, and advanced positions. Entry-level mechanics handle basic tasks, while intermediate mechanics perform more complex repairs, and advanced mechanics lead maintenance teams and oversee major repairs.

                In flight mechanic jobs, the terms "aircraft mechanic" and "aircraft technician" are often used interchangeably. However, while an aircraft mechanic focuses on inspecting, maintaining, and repairing aircraft systems, an aircraft technician may have broader roles, including technical support and troubleshooting.

                In flight mechanic jobs, aircraft mechanics are typically responsible for inspecting, maintaining, and repairing aircraft systems rather than flying planes. While some aircraft mechanics may hold pilot licenses as a personal interest or for specific job requirements, their primary role is to ensure the safety and airworthiness of aircraft through maintenance activities rather than piloting.
